Grief and a stubborn sense of unfinished business pull a famous doctor back toward the shadows he thought he'd left behind in this 2025 mystery drama built around one of literature's most enduring supporting characters.

What is Watson about?

A year removed from the loss of his closest friend and longtime partner, Dr. John Watson has rebuilt his life around a clinic devoted to patients with rare and baffling conditions. The work suits him: methodical, medical, mostly free of danger. But old habits of observation and deduction resurface as cases at the clinic start carrying stranger edges than ordinary illness, and Watson finds that stepping away from his past does not mean his past is finished with him. Colleagues and patients alike become entangled in a slow unraveling of secrets connected to the life he tried to leave behind.

Cast & crew

Morris Chestnut headlines as Watson, supported by Tommy O'Brien, Eve Harlow, and Nature Trammer in roles spanning the clinic staff and the wider circle drawn into his investigations.

Context & significance

Craig Sweeney directs the series, which reframes a familiar literary figure as the lead rather than the sidekick, shifting the emphasis from deduction theater to medical mystery. Episodes run about 45 minutes, and the show carries an IMDb rating of 5.6, positioning it as an accessible procedural drama with a literary hook.
